Output 98931884ca9ad63686fcd601769c302a82a9a467087fd6aae0098c8438037072:8

value
10183440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c7b003b7a290bda85087466a1225f3116b58d15 OP_EQUAL
address
MBxMK885EwVqmzqVMSCsngL6yxtF54sUgt
transaction
98931884ca9ad63686fcd601769c302a82a9a467087fd6aae0098c8438037072
spent
true